TREVELLE HARP NAMED EXECUTIVE DIRECTOR
OF NEIGHBORHOOD LEADERSHIP INSTITUTE
 
The Board of Directors of Neighborhood Leadership Institute (NLI) is pleased to share that Trevelle Harp has been named the new Executive Director of the organization. He will begin on April 3, 2023 and lead the organization’s efforts encompassing neighborhood leadership, community health, True2U mentoring and youth engagement.

NLI Board President Harold Pretel states, “Throughout the interview process, Trevelle presented qualities and experiences which confirmed him as the most desirable candidate. He displays a great understanding of our mission and a programmatic depth of knowledge that will support and broaden our program areas while reassuring our community and staff the Institute is in good hands. We are fortunate to have a leader of his caliber, character, and spirit take the helm and partner with us into the future.”   
Harp previously worked at Northeast Ohio Alliance for Hope in East Cleveland, Ohio. He joined that organization in 2008 and served as its Executive Director since 2010. He brings valuable experience and expertise in program development, organizing, fundraising and community leadership to NLI. Trevelle is a graduate of Neighborhood Leadership Cleveland (Class 24) as well as the Community Development Corporation Leadership Program. He currently serves on the Board of Directors for Fund for Our Economic Future.

Trevelle states, “I have always believed that a community’s greatest asset is its people. Throughout my career, I have passionately adhered to that philosophy and look forward to continuing that focus at Neighborhood Leadership Institute. As an NLC graduate, I am excited to be back with the NLI community and am honored to build on the legacy that the organization and its past leaders have created.”

An extensive search process led by the NLI Board of Directors and Janus Small Associates began in October 2022 with a survey that captured community input on the position. Harp will lead a staff of 13 at NLI and an alumni base of over 1,300 Neighborhood Leadership Cleveland graduates.
